One of Sydney’s most exclusive Clubs

On 15th September 1893 the NSW Masonic Musical and Literary Society was founded, later to become the NSW Masonic Club. From a modest enrolment, membership grew through the years to many thousands, as did the need for a suitable home. Land was purchased and, on 12th September 1927, the current premises, at 169-171 Castlereagh Street, were officially opened – and what a magnificent home it is!

Remarkable for its architectural impressiveness and internal beauty, the Club stands 12 floors high and, when first opened, was the tallest building in Sydney. The building is heritage-listed, renowned for its historical significance, and imbues a touch of “old-world charm” throughout.

Entrusted with this heritage jewel, the Board of Directors undertakes a continual program of restoration and enhancement, from the exquisite handmade carpet of The Boardroom to the ornate art deco detail and magnificent sandstone streetscape.

Currently comprising of a street café, elegant bars and lounges, seven function rooms and the magnificent Cellos Grand Dining Room, the Club also operates under the banner of “Castlereagh Boutique Hotel”. Featuring 83 boutique-style accommodation rooms, a stay at the hotel is a wonderfully unique experience enjoyed by Members and visitors.

In the 1920s the Club’s dining room and ballroom were bustling with the “who’s who” of society – debonair gentleman and ladies adorned with georgette and sequins. Almost 100 years later the Club still boasts a lively Membership who regularly enjoy the many facilities and benefits the Club has to offer.
